You wan to clean the salt and stuff off the outside with a toothbrush and warm water. You may need to scrub lightly with a slightly used scotchbrite pad depending on whose reel you are cleaning. To clean off the grease you will need some sort of solvent, alcohol works ok and isn't too harsh on the plastic parts. For grease you can use most quality waterproof greases, Superlube is a silicone based grease that works well and some guys use lower unit grease. I use grease on gears and shafts and oil on bearings, you may need to re oil the bearings throughout the season.

If you need parts Bucko's in Fall River is a good source, most shops probably have Penn parts available.
